Deutz-Allis 8070

The Deutz-Allis 8070 is a row-crop tractor produced from 1985 to 1988 by Deutz-Allis in West Allis, Wisconsin, USA. It is the same model as the Allis Chalmers 8070. A total of 2,354 units were built. It features a 7.0L 6-cylinder turbocharged intercooled diesel engine with 145.36 hp drawbar power and 170.72 hp PTO power (tested). The tractor offers two transmission options: a 20-speed partial power shift and a 12-speed Allis-Chalmers power shift. It has two- or four-wheel drive, electro-hydraulic rear differential lock, hydrostatic power steering, and differential hydraulic wet disc brakes. The Acousta cab comes standard with heat and air-conditioning, with optional radio and cassette player. Fuel capacity is 60 gallons with an optional 25-gallon tank. The tractor hitch is category III/II with a rear lift capacity of 8,200 lbs at 24 inches. Dimensions include a 106-inch wheelbase, 187-inch length, and widths of 95.5 inches or 119.5 inches with a long axle. Operating weight ranges from 16,850 lbs (2WD duals) to 17,300 lbs (4WD), with a ballasted weight of 22,370 lbs. Electrical system includes a 12-volt battery and 100-amp alternator.

Transmission

Transmission 1

Type:partial power shift
Gears:20 forward and 4 reverse
Model:Allis-Chalmers Power Director
Description:Five gears (1-5) in two ranges (slow/fast) with a two-speed power shift (low/high) controlled by left-hand lever.
Oil capacity:29.6 qts (28.0 L)

Transmission 2

Type:Power Shift
Gears:12 forward and 2 reverse
Model:Allis-Chalmers
Description:Six power shift gears (1-6) in two ranges (slow/fast). Clutch must be used to shift range. Pressing the clutch pedal half-way automatically downshifts from 5th/6th to 4th gear.
Oil capacity:29.6 qts (28.0 L)
